The Basics Knowledge of Credit Cards
Credit cards have become an integral part of our daily lives, enabling us to make purchases conveniently and securely. They work by allowing cardholders to borrow money from a financial institution to make purchases, which are then paid back either in full at the end of the billing cycle or over time with interest. Understanding the basics of Credit Cards is crucial in order to make the most of their features and avoid common pitfalls.

Know About All Types of Credit Cards
Credit cards come in a variety of types, each designed to cater to different needs and preferences. Some common types include:
- Rewards Credit Cards: These cards offer incentives such as cash back, travel rewards, or points that can be redeemed for various benefits. By leveraging the right rewards program, you can earn valuable perks on your everyday spending.
- Low-Interest Credit Cards: These cards are ideal for individuals who anticipate carrying a balance on their card. They offer lower interest rates, minimizing the cost of borrowing over time.
- Balance Transfer Credit Cards: If you have existing credit card debt, balance transfer cards allow you to transfer your balance from one card to another with a lower interest rate or promotional period. This can help you consolidate your debt and potentially save on interest charges.
- Secured Credit Cards: Geared towards individuals with limited or no credit history, secured cards require a cash deposit as collateral. They are a great tool for building or rebuilding credit.
- Travel Credit Card: A travel credit card is designed specifically for frequent travelers, offering benefits such as global acceptance, travel rewards, and insurance coverage. It allows you to conveniently make payments worldwide, earn points or miles for travel-related expenses, and provides protections against unforeseen circumstances during your trips.
- Fuel Credit Card: A fuel credit card is tailored for individuals who frequently purchase fuel. It offers cashback or rewards specifically on fuel expenses, helping you save money on gas or diesel purchases. Some cards may also provide additional benefits like discounts at partner fuel stations.
- Secured Credit Card: A secured credit card is that requires a security deposit, typically equal to the card’s credit limit. It is designed for individuals with limited or no credit history, helping them build or rebuild their credit. By responsibly using the card and making timely payments, users can establish a positive credit history.
- Business Credit Card: A business credit card is aimed at entrepreneurs and small business owners. It provides them with a dedicated line of credit for business-related expenses, enabling better expense tracking and separating personal and business finances. These cards often offer rewards and perks tailored to business needs, such as cashback on business purchases or travel rewards for business trips.
- Student Credit Card: A student credit card is designed for students who are new to credit. It offers a lower credit limit and is an excellent tool for building credit history responsibly. These cards often have features like no annual fees and rewards tailored to student needs, such as cashback on dining or textbooks.
- Cashback Credit Card: A cashback credit card allows users to earn a percentage of their purchases back as cash rewards. The cardholder receives a certain percentage of cashback on eligible purchases, which can be redeemed or used to offset future credit card bills. It is a popular choice for individuals who prefer straightforward rewards and savings.
- Lifestyle Credit Card: A lifestyle credit card caters to individuals who have specific spending preferences or interests. These cards offer rewards and benefits aligned with the cardholder’s lifestyle choices, such as discounts on dining, travel perks, access to exclusive events, or rewards for shopping at specific stores or brands.
- Entertainment Credit Card: An entertainment credit card focuses on providing benefits related to entertainment and leisure activities. It offers perks like discounts on movie tickets, concert tickets, theme park admissions, or access to exclusive events and experiences in the entertainment industry.
- Shopping Credit Card: A shopping credit card is designed for individuals who frequently shop at specific retailers or brands. These cards often offer rewards, discounts, or cashback specifically for purchases made at partner stores, making them an attractive option for frequent shoppers who want to maximize their savings while indulging in their retail therapy.

Get the Special Benefits of Using Credit Cards
Credit cards have become an integral part of our financial lives, offering numerous benefits and convenience to cardholders. Here, we’ll explore some of the key benefits of using credit cards in today’s financial landscape.
Convenience and Ease of Use
One of the primary benefits of using credit cards is the convenience they provide. With a credit card in hand, you can make purchases quickly and easily, whether you’re shopping in-store, online, or over the phone. The process is simple: just swipe or insert your card, and the transaction is complete. No need to carry cash or write checks, making credit cards a convenient payment method in our fast-paced world.
Building Credit History
Using a credit card responsibly is an effective way to build your credit history. By making regular, on-time payments and keeping your credit utilization low, you demonstrate to lenders and credit bureaus that you are a reliable borrower. Over time, this positive credit behavior can lead to an excellent credit score, opening doors to better Credit Card Loan terms, lower interest rates, and improved financial opportunities.
Emergency Fund
Credit cards can serve as an emergency fund when unexpected expenses arise. Whether it’s a medical bill, car repair, or home maintenance, having a credit card can provide immediate financial relief. Instead of depleting your savings or struggling to gather funds, you can use your credit card to cover the expenses and pay it off over time, giving you peace of mind during challenging situations.
Safety and Security
Credit cards offer enhanced security compared to carrying cash. If your credit card is lost or stolen, you can quickly report it and have it deactivated, preventing unauthorized use. Additionally, most credit card companies have robust fraud protection measures in place, which can provide additional peace of mind when making purchases. In case of fraudulent activity, you are typically not liable for unauthorized charges.
Rewards and Perks
One of the most enticing benefits of using credit cards is the opportunity to earn rewards and enjoy perks. Many credit cards offer cashback, travel rewards, points, or airline miles for every purchase you make. These rewards can add up over time, allowing you to save money or redeem them for travel, merchandise, or other desirable benefits. Additionally, credit cards often come with perks such as extended warranties, purchase protection, and access to exclusive events or discounts.
Budgeting and Tracking Expenses
Credit cards can be a valuable tool for budgeting and tracking your expenses. Most credit card companies provide detailed statements that categorize your spending, making it easier to understand where your money is going. Some credit cards even offer budgeting tools or spending alerts, helping you stay on top of your financial goals and monitor your spending habits.

Credit Card Fees and Charges
While Credit Cards Offer numerous benefits, it’s essential to understand the fees and charges associated with them. Familiarize yourself with common fees such as annual fees, late payment fees, cash advance fees, and foreign transaction fees. Being aware of these costs empowers you to choose cards that align with your financial goals and minimize unnecessary expenses.

To maximize the benefits of credit cards and avoid potential pitfalls, responsible credit card management is crucial. Consider the following strategies:
a. Pay Your Balance in Full: Whenever possible, aim to pay your credit card balance in full each month. This not only helps you avoid interest charges but also promotes healthy financial habits.
b. Monitor Your Spending: Regularly review your credit card statements and track your spending. This enables you to identify any fraudulent activity and helps you stay within your budget.
c. Set Up Payment Reminders: Late payments can result in hefty fees and negatively impact your credit score. Set up payment reminders or automate payments to ensure you never miss a due date.
d. Keep Your Credit Utilization Low: Credit utilization refers to the percentage of your available credit that you’re currently using. Aim to keep your utilization ratio below 30% to maintain a healthy credit score.
